4-digit postcode 2622 covers Delft, South Holland. Dutch postcodes are four digits and two letters. The four digits identify a delivery area, and it is the level Statistics Netherlands publishes against, so the figures below describe this postcode itself rather than the town around it.

Figures from Statistics Netherlands (CBS), key figures per postcode, 1 January 2025. CBS withholds figures for areas with too few residents to publish safely, so a missing value here means withheld, not zero.
